    Question Linked Playlist Won't Read .M3U Created by Mezzmo

    I created several playlists with Mezzmo and exported them as .M3U files for use in WMP. Worked fine. Then I uninstalled and reinstalled Mezzmo V4.1.3.0. I elected to uninstall the Mezzmo catalog too. So all the playlists in Mezzmo went away as expected. I then tried to create a Linked Playlist which referenced one of the .M3U files previously created by Mezzmo. The resulting playlist in Mezzmo is empty. Same with all the M3U files created by Mezzmo. Linked Playlists referencing .wpl files created by WMP work fine.

    This is supposed to work. Suggestions?
